Understanding Phrenic Nerve Surgery

The phrenic nerve plays an essential role in our respiratory system. Originating in the neck (C3-C5), it controls the diaphragm – the muscle that separates the chest cavity from the abdomen, facilitating breathing. Damage or impairment to this nerve can lead to severe respiratory complications, requiring phrenic nerve surgery.

Phrenic nerve surgery is a highly specialized procedure that often includes nerve decompression, nerve grafting, or nerve transfer. The chosen surgical procedure often depends on the nature and severity of the damage. The main goal is to restore the function of the diaphragm and significantly improve the patient's quality of life.

What Makes a Great Hospital for Phrenic Nerve Surgery?

Cutting-edge Technology

In the domain of phrenic nerve surgery, advanced technology can make a world of difference. High-tech diagnostic tools such as electromyography (EMG), nerve conduction studies (NCS), and ultrasound imaging can precisely detect nerve damage. For the surgery itself, state-of-the-art operating theaters equipped with sophisticated surgical instruments are indispensable.

Risks and Outcomes

While phrenic nerve surgery can significantly enhance the patient's quality of life, it's essential to understand the potential risks. These may include infection, bleeding, nerve damage, and adverse reactions to anesthesia. The right hospital and surgeon should openly discuss these risks and take measures to mitigate them.

The expected outcomes vary depending on the nature and extent of the nerve damage. However, most patients experience noticeable improvement in their breathing function and overall quality of life post-surgery.
